package controllers
import (
"context"
v2 "github.com/fluxcd/helm-controller/api/v2beta1"
"github.com/go-logr/logr"
corev1 "k8s.io/api/core/v1"
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
"k8s.io/apimachinery/pkg/runtime"
"sigs.k8s.io/controller-runtime/pkg/client/fake"
"sigs.k8s.io/controller-runtime/pkg/log"
"sync"
fuzz "github.com/AdaLogics/go-fuzz-headers"
)
var (
initter sync.Once
scheme *runtime.Scheme
)
// An init function that is invoked by way of sync.Do
func initFunc() {
scheme = runtime.NewScheme()
err := corev1.AddToScheme(scheme)
if err != nil {
panic(err)
}
err = v2.AddToScheme(scheme)
if err != nil {
panic(err)
}
}
// FuzzHelmreleaseComposeValues implements a fuzzer
// that targets HelmReleaseReconciler.composeValues()
func FuzzHelmreleaseComposeValues(data []byte) int {
initter.Do(initFunc)
f := fuzz.NewConsumer(data)
hr := v2.HelmRelease{}
err := f.GenerateStruct(&hr)
if err != nil {
return 0
}
r, err := createReconciler(f)
if err != nil {
return 0
}
_, _ = r.composeValues(logr.NewContext(context.TODO(), log.NullLogger{}), hr)
return 1
}
// FuzzHelmreleasereconcile implements a fuzzer
// that targets HelmReleaseReconciler.reconcile()
func FuzzHelmreleasereconcile(data []byte) int {
initter.Do(initFunc)
f := fuzz.NewConsumer(data)
hr := v2.HelmRelease{}
err := f.GenerateStruct(&hr)
if err != nil {
return 0
}
r, err := createReconciler(f)
if err != nil {
return 0
}
_, _, _ = r.reconcile(logr.NewContext(context.TODO(), log.NullLogger{}), hr)
return 1
}
// Allows the fuzzer to create a reconciler
func createReconciler(f *fuzz.ConsumeFuzzer) (*HelmReleaseReconciler, error) {
// Get the type of object:
var resources []runtime.Object
r := &HelmReleaseReconciler{}
getSecret, err := f.GetBool()
if err != nil {
return r, err
}
name, err := f.GetString()
if err != nil {
return r, err
}
if getSecret {
inputMap := make(map[string][]byte)
err = f.FuzzMap(&inputMap)
if err != nil {
return r, err
}
resources = []runtime.Object{
valuesSecret(name, inputMap),
}
} else {
inputMap := make(map[string]string)
err = f.FuzzMap(&inputMap)
if err != nil {
return r, err
}
resources = []runtime.Object{
valuesConfigMap(name, inputMap),
}
}
c := fake.NewFakeClientWithScheme(scheme, resources...)
r.Client = c
return r, nil
}
// Taken from
// https://github.com/fluxcd/helm-controller/blob/main/controllers/helmrelease_controller_test.go#L282
func valuesSecret(name string, data map[string][]byte) *corev1.Secret {
return &corev1.Secret{
ObjectMeta: metav1.ObjectMeta{Name: name},
Data: data,
}
}
// Taken from
// https://github.com/fluxcd/helm-controller/blob/main/controllers/helmrelease_controller_test.go#L289
func valuesConfigMap(name string, data map[string]string) *corev1.ConfigMap {
return &corev1.ConfigMap{
ObjectMeta: metav1.ObjectMeta{Name: name},
Data: data,
}
}
